Course Content

• Water Audit & Assessment Techniques for Schools
• Implementing Water-Saving Technologies in Educational Facilities
• Developing a School-Wide Water Conservation Plan (including curriculum integration)
• Behaviour Change Strategies for Water Conservation (student & staff engagement)
• Leak Detection and Repair: Practical Skills & Maintenance
• Landscaping and Irrigation Management for Water Efficiency
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Water-Saving Initiatives (data analysis & reporting)
• Funding & Resource Management for Water Conservation Projects
• Collaboration and Stakeholder Engagement for School Water Programs
• Case Studies: Successful Water-Saving Initiatives in Schools (best practices)
